Vine pruning is a vital practice for preserving healthy development, managing size, and improving fruit or flower production. Routine pruning removes dead, harmed, or overcrowded stems, which enhances airflow, light penetration, and minimizes the threat of disease. Appropriate timing and method depend on the type of vine, its development practice, and the desired result, whether for decorative functions or fruit production. Techniques such as heading cuts, thinning cuts, and training along trellises or supports guide the plant's growth and enhance structural strength. Pruning also encourages vigorous brand-new shoots and flowering, while keeping vines from becoming intrusive or overgrown. A constant pruning schedule promotes long-term health and visual appeal, guaranteeing vines stay appealing and productive. Proper vine management adds to general landscape aesthetic appeals and improves the functionality of garden functions such as arbors, pergolas, and fences
